Equatorial Guinea quarantines 200 after unknown hemorrhagic fever deaths

Summary by Ground News
Cameroon has restricted movement along its border with Equatorial Guinea. The restrictions are to prevent the spread of an unknown illness. The symptoms of the illness include fever, vomiting and joint pain. The illness has been reported in two villages near Cameroon's capital, Yaounde.
